Robot vacuums have become a household staple, and they are available at different prices. With advances in smart technology, many can now be able to map rooms and avoid obstacles. They can also be controlled by smartphones or voice assistants.
Some even do double-duty as automated mop cleaners. And they're all designed to take the work away from a gruelling chore.
Safety
Many people have concerns about smart home appliances, like robot vacuums with cameras. These devices are connected to the Internet which means that hackers can access them and make use of them to spy. But, this isn't a problem that can affect all smart devices, because different gadgets have varying levels of security protocols.
Sensors are included in the majority of premium robot vacuum cleaners to aid them avoid obstacles and navigate. Laser navigation systems are utilized by the most advanced robot vacuum cleaners to make digital maps and plot routes. This is crucial for safety and cleaning efficiency as it ensures that the robot will not hit furniture or other objects that could damage it.
Certain models also come with a camera that allows the user to see and control the device through the smartphone app or through voice commands. This is a great feature that allows you to check for rogue dust bunnies or other objects in the area, and it can also be useful for troubleshooting. But, many people don't realize that the cameras on their robot vacuums are not secured and can be accessible to anyone with a good knowledge of the Internet and a small amount of knowledge.
Although the majority of robotic vacuums are secured by multiple layers of security, it is true that no device is 100% secure from hacking and data theft. Most modern smartphones have top-of-the-line security features, however these are susceptible to attacks if they are not properly configured and maintained. Other smart devices, such as TVs and switchboards in the home or in the camera, robot vacuums and even robot vacuums, are also at risk.
Most premium robot vacuums require an Internet connection to work, but certain models can operate offline. To prevent hackers piggybacking on your connection and observing other devices connected to your network, you should make sure that all Wi-Fi routers at home have WPA2 or higher encryption and that your passwords are difficult and complex to guess. In addition, you should only connect your robotic vacuums only to their dedicated Wi-Fi networks and not connect them to other smart devices such as computers or tablets.
Flexibility
Robot vacuums and mop cleaners are becoming more accessible with features that were previously considered high-end now being included in midrange models. This has resulted in several improvements in their cleaning performance as well as navigation capabilities, noise levels and ease of operation.
Autonomous vacuums that make use of advanced mapping technology are able to recognize and avoid objects and navigate around furniture with great accuracy. They can also move between rooms without becoming stuck. They can adjust their route to make sure they can clean every corner of your home. They can even get into tight spaces where other robots struggle.
Mapping technology is a basic requirement for any robot vacuum that vacuums and mops vacuum worth its price in 2024. Auto-vacuums without it frequently fall into furniture, get caught in cords or shoes and become distracted by pet toys and toys, which can cause disruption to the cleaning process and leave behind missed spots. Smart mapping is available on budget-friendly models made by trusted brands such as Shark or Roborock. It's worth the extra cost.
Certain robots allow you to create virtual barriers within the app, that prevent your device from entering certain areas of your home. For example around a pile, or dog poop. This feature is especially useful when you have pets or children who tend to leave things lying around. You can create several no-go zones and schedule them to operate at different times of the day depending on your schedule.
Another great feature is auto vacuum and mop-empty, which shifts the contents of a robotic bin to a bigger storage bag that is placed inside its base station, reducing the amount of time you spend emptying and maintaining the robot. This makes it a lot easier to keep your home cleaner with less effort and lowers the risk of developing allergies thanks to less exposure to dust and autonomous vacuum debris.
Another helpful option is docking stations that replace the mop pads for you to save you from having to do it manually. It's an especially convenient feature if you have kids and pets that tend to frequent the same area often for example, near the kitchen or family room.

Cleaning
Robot vacuum cleaners combine powerful mopping and vacuuming into one device. This makes them an effective cleaning tool for floors. They work autonomously to sweep, vacuum and mop according to pre-set schedules, thereby saving your time and energy while improving the cleanliness of your home. The high-efficiency filters remove dust particles, pet hairs dead skin cells, and allergens from the surface, allowing you to maintain a healthy indoor air quality. Some models even self-empty to help ease maintenance needs.
Some of the most sophisticated robotic vacuums make use of laser navigation systems to map a space. LiDAR sensors at the base of these machines bounce infrared beams off the floors and walls to determine distances. This creates digital maps that allow them to navigate efficiently. This technology is more precise than conventional ultrasonic or infrared sensor, which are more sensitive to changes in lighting conditions. It is also less susceptible to interference, which makes it an ideal choice for different types of surfaces.
Another smart navigation feature in some autonomous vacuums is object recognition. This sensor-based technology can detect moving objects such as shoes, toys and charging cords to prevent them from being a problem while cleaning and avoid accidents like collisions and damage to furniture. Moreover, smart vacuums have remote monitoring capabilities that let you view live videos of your home via an app on your mobile. You can monitor their status, alter the schedule and settings, and monitor battery levels on the go. Some of them even have voice commands making it easier for people with physical or mobility limitations to use. For instance, DEEBOT has a YIKO voice assistant that understands natural voice commands and allows users to begin and stop, pause, Autonomous Vacuum or schedule tasks on the go.
